[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of computer, in particular to a virtual camera shooting parameter adjustment method and device, electronic equipment and storage medium. BACKGROUND

[0002] In a 3D game, a virtual character will play a game plot after triggering a plot event. In order to make the game plot more rich and improve the experience of plot watching, the virtual camera generally adopts a shooting method of over-the-shoulder view angle. In the prior art, a designer designs many sets of two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ting templates. The two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template can only show a two-dimensional plane to the designer, and cannot show a three-dimensional display effect to the designer. The designer configures different two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ting templates for different game plots according to the display effect of the two-dimensional plane, so that the virtual character uses the corresponding two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template to shoot when triggering the game plot. When using the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template to shoot, the shooting direction, the shooting angle and the shooting position of the virtual camera are fixed. However, in the actual game, the height difference and the relative position of the virtual character and the target object triggering the game plot are not fixed. Therefore, when using the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template to shoot, it cannot perfectly adapt to the current game scene, resulting in that the displayed picture cannot achieve the display effect designed by the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template. For example, when the height difference between the virtual character and the target object is large, the head of the target object may not be completely displayed in the game picture, resulting in poor display effect of the game picture. [0029] It should be noted in advance that the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template is a template information in which the positions and orientations of characters and shots are determined in advance by a designer in electronic game production, which can be conveniently applied to conventional game plot production to quickly generate shot positions for character dialog and realize over-the-shoulder shooting (also called over-the-shoulder shooting).

[0030] Over-the-shoulder shooting refers to a shooting method in which a virtual camera is aimed at the shoulder position of a virtual character to shoot the virtual character (also called a controlled virtual character) and a target object. This shooting method can make the player better feel the perspective and scene when having a dialog with the target object, can increase the realism of the communication between the virtual character and the target object, and can make the player more easily immersed in the game plot and better understand and experience the dialog interaction in the game.

[0031] The two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template is provided with shooting parameters, and the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template can display a two-dimensional picture effect for the designer, the two-dimensional picture including the distance between the virtual character and the target object and the positions of the virtual character and the target object in the picture, i.e., the distance from the edge of the picture. The shooting parameters can determine the shooting direction, shooting position, and lens tilt angle of the virtual camera and other information.

[0039] ​Specifically, the player can control the controlled virtual character to move in the game scene, and make the controlled virtual character execute corresponding game instructions. The game scene includes many virtual characters or objects (i.e., target objects) that can trigger a plot event, such as: NPC (non-player character) in the game, buildings, stones, vegetation, and even two virtual characters controlled by players. When the player controls the controlled virtual character to approach or click the target object, the corresponding plot event is triggered, thereby triggering the corresponding plot, and the designer pre-configures a corresponding two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template for different plots. After the plot is triggered, the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template configured for the corresponding plot (i.e., target plot) is called to obtain the basic parameters of the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template. Since the relative positions of the first target part (for example, the head) of the controlled virtual character and the second target part (such as the head) of the target object, and the height difference of the first target part of the controlled virtual character and the second target part of the target object may be different from the relative positions of the first target part of the controlled virtual character and the second target part of the target object and the height difference set in the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template, if the over-the-shoulder shooting is performed according to the parameters set in the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template, the picture effect obtained cannot reach the target picture effect set by the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template for the plot scene.

[0040] The relative positions of the first target part of the controlled virtual character and the second target part of the target object, and the height difference of the first target part of the controlled virtual character and the second target part of the target object may be different from the relative positions of the first target part of the controlled virtual character and the second target part of the target object and the height difference set in the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template. If the difference is compensated on the basis of the parameters set in the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template, the over-the-shoulder shooting is performed by using the compensated parameters, and the picture effect obtained at this time can reach the picture effect set by the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template for the plot scene. Therefore, it is necessary to determine a first vector formed by the positions of the first target part and the second target part of the controlled virtual character in the plot scene, and a second vector formed by the positions of the first target part and the second target part set in the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template in the viewing volume of the virtual camera, then convert the second vector into the first vector, and determine the translation matrix, rotation matrix and scaling matrix occurring in the conversion process, so as to obtain a conversion matrix according to the above three matrices.

[0041] If the compensation is made by only the conversion matrix based on the parameters of the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template, when the shooting position of the virtual camera is adjusted by the compensated parameters, the lens tilt angle of the virtual camera set in the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template needs to be compensated because the lens tilt angle of the virtual camera after the compensation is deflected (caused by the rotation matrix) relative to the lens tilt angle set in the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template. At this time, the included angle between the third vector generated when the lens tilt angle vector set in the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template is projected onto the normal plane corresponding to the first vector pair and the lens tilt angle vector is determined as the first rotation matrix.

[0042] After the first rotation matrix and the conversion matrix are obtained, the shooting position, the lens tilt angle vector and the shooting direction vector of the virtual camera set in the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template are adjusted by the first rotation matrix and the conversion matrix. The shooting position and the shooting direction of the virtual camera after the adjustment are proportionally adjusted with the shooting position and the shooting direction of the virtual camera set in the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template, and the shooting direction is also adjusted according to the relative position and the height difference of the first target part and the second target part. Therefore, when the virtual camera shoots the scene corresponding to the target plot according to the adjusted two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template, the picture effect is the same as the picture effect set in the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template. Therefore, the above method is helpful to improve the display effect of the game picture.

[0043] It should be noted that the first target part and the second target part can be the same part or different parts. For example, the first target part can be an arm, and the second target part can be a head. Alternatively, the first target part can be a head, and the second target part can be an arm. Alternatively, the first target part can be a shoulder, and the second target part can be a leg. The specific part can be set according to the actual scene and requirements, which is not limited here.

[0044] When the virtual camera shoots, the shooting space is a cone shape, and the space area is a view cone.

[0045] In a feasible embodiment, Figure 2 A schematic diagram of over-shoulder shooting provided for the embodiment of the application, Figure 2 The dotted arrow in indicates the shooting direction of the virtual camera, Figure 2 The virtual camera in shoots the shoulder of the controlled virtual character, Figure 3 A schematic diagram of the position set in the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template provided for the embodiment of the application, Figure 3 In the two-dimensional over-shoulder shooting template, the dotted arrow indicates the lens tilt angle (i.e. the angle rotated with the shooting direction as the axis), and the dotted line indicates the shooting direction, as shown in Figure 2 and Figure 3As shown, the first position of the first target part in the visual cone, the second position of the second target part in the visual cone, the third position of the virtual camera in the plot scene, the fourth position for indicating the shooting direction of the virtual camera and the fifth position for indicating the vertical direction of the shooting picture of the virtual camera are set in the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template, and the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template defines the target picture effect through the first position, the second position, the third position, the fourth position and the fifth position; the lens tilt vector is obtained through the third position and the fifth position, and the shooting direction vector is obtained through the third position and the fourth position.

[0046] In a feasible implementation, Figure 4 Another flowchart of the adjustment method of the virtual camera shooting parameter provided by the embodiment is shown in the figure. Figure 4 As shown in step 105, the following steps can be implemented:

[0047] Step 401, multiply the rotation matrix in the conversion matrix and the first rotation matrix to obtain a second rotation matrix.

[0048] Step 402, adjust the third position and the shooting direction vector according to the translation matrix and the scaling matrix in the conversion matrix.

[0049] Step 403, adjust the lens tilt vector according to the second rotation matrix and taking the first vector as the rotation axis.

[0050] Specifically, the virtual camera can be adjusted according to the difference between the first vector and the second vector on the basis of the two-dimensional over-the-shoulder shooting template through the conversion matrix, but the lens tilt of the adjusted virtual camera is deviated from the lens tilt of the target picture effect, so the second rotation matrix obtained by multiplying the rotation matrix in the conversion matrix and the first rotation matrix is needed to adjust the lens tilt, so that the adjusted shooting position, lens tilt vector and shooting direction are the same as the target picture effect.
